法甲联赛积分系统排名软件深度解析:从数据源到算法再到可视化的玩法

2025-10-02 19:31:41 体育新闻 nvtutu

各位球迷朋友,桌面上泡着热气腾腾的拿铁,屏幕里却在蹦出一堆数字和表格。今天我要聊的不是单纯的比分,而是法甲联赛积分系统排名软件的全流程,从数据源到排序算法再到可视化呈现,像带你逛完一个数据版的球迷嘉年华。

先把“积分系统”捋清楚:在大多数联赛里,球队靠比赛结果积累分数,胜一场得3分,平局各得1分,输球就0分。最终的排名不是只看分数,还要把净胜球、进球数、对阵记录等作为辅助条件来决定谁先谁后。简单说,就是把一张看似简单的表格,变成一个有等级、有层次的排行榜。这个过程看起来像拼多多拼降价,可是背后其实是严谨的规则与高效的数据处理。

要做出可靠的法甲积分排名软件,首要任务是数据。官方赛果当然是核心,但真实世界里,常常需要参考多源数据来修复延迟、弥补误差,例如官方公告、比赛结果、进球信息、黄牌红牌、换人记录、关键事件时间线、伤停信息、对阵历史等。把这些信息汇总在一个统一的数据模型里,才能让排名不再靠传闻,而是靠可追溯的数据流。

其次是数据管道。数据进入系统后,通常要经过清洗、去重、标准化、时间对齐等步骤。不同来源的时间戳、球队命名、字段命名可能不一致,需要统一成同一口径。这个阶段就像裁判确认犯规点一样关键,少一处错误就会导致整张表的可信度下降,进而影响媒体报道和球队决策。

第三步是排名算法的骨架。最核心的是积分的计算,但真正落地要考虑如何处理并列情况、赛程密度波动、比赛延期等因素。通常会设计一个“主表+辅助条件”的多层排序:之一优先级是总分,其次是净胜球,再下是进球数,接着可能引入对阵近况、最近5场的胜率等作为边缘排序条件。这样可以在并列时给出更符合实际场面感觉的排序结果。

关于并列的处理,很多人关心:对阵头对头算不算?不同联赛规则有差异。法甲和多数欧洲联赛惯用的做法是先看净胜球、再看进球数,若仍未分出胜负,才进入其他定制化的备选条件。为避免混乱,软件通常会把这些条件以清晰的优先级列出,并在前端给出逐项对比的可视化。

为了让排序结果更可靠,系统还需要处理比赛的时间维度与数据时效性。实时性高的排名需要边打边算,延迟型的可以每小时一次更新。无论哪种方式,数据一致性和版本控制都很重要:同一轮比赛的结果在不同数据源之间应保持一致,历史版本也要可回溯,防止回放时出现错位。

在实现层面,常见的技术选型包括Python、SQL、ETL工具、API网关、消息队列和缓存系统。数据源多、更新频繁,选用强一致性的数据模型和高效的缓存策略是提升查询速度的关键。前端可以用表格、趋势线、热力图等多种可视化组件,帮助媒体、球队和粉丝快速把握动态。

为了让系统具备实用性,数据质量管理不可忽视。数据清洗不仅要处理字段不一致,还要对异常值、延迟数据和缺失值进行合理处理。常见的策略包括时间对齐、插值、以及对历史数据的回测,确保回放时序的连续性没有“断档”。

法甲联赛积分系统排名软件

在排名计算之外,软件还应该提供历史对比、趋势分析和情境模拟等功能。历史对比可以让你看到不同赛季的排名波动,情境模拟则能回答“如果某场比赛结果不同,最终名次会怎样?”这类问题,极大提升报道的深度和互动性。

可视化方面,除了基础的积分表格,还可以加入走势线、球队热区地图、进球分布热力图、对阵强弱区分析等。这样的可视化不仅美观,还能让编辑在新闻稿中直接嵌入图表,提高读者理解速度和停留时长。对于数据驱动的内容,图表往往比纯文字更有传播力。

面对不同用户群体,软件需要提供定制化的视图和导出能力。媒体用户可能需要可嵌入的报表、可下载的CSV/图片文件;球队和分析师则需要更细粒度的比赛级别数据、API访问以及自定义指标。API设计要清晰、稳定,文档要友好,错误码要详尽,方便前端和第三方应用对接。

关于实现细节,下面给出一个高层次的示例结构:数据源层负责抓取与清洗,存储层采用关系型数据库+时序数据库组合,计算层实现排序和逻辑规则,API层向前端与外部系统提供访问入口,前端则做可视化和交互。不同模块之间通过清晰的接口解耦,方便后续扩展和维护。

在选型时,软件应该关注数据源的稳定性、更新频率、以及版权与使用许可。数据源不稳定会导致排名“抖动”,这对新闻报道与分析结论来说都不好看。高质量的系统需要有容错设计、数据版本管理以及变更记录,避免因小失大。

至于用户体验,界面要友好、交互要顺畅,尽量用直观的颜色与标记帮助读者快速理解。比如同分时用高对比度的颜色表示领先方,用箭头显示走势方向,鼠标悬停给出逐项对比的简要要点。幽默风趣的用语和 *** 梗可以缓和技术感,让内容更具亲和力。

在实际落地过程中,分阶段推进往往事半功倍。之一阶段聚焦核心数据源与基础排序,第二阶段加入可视化与导出能力,第三阶段引入历史对比与情境模拟,第四阶段完善权限、日志与监控。每个阶段都要做回顾与迭代,确保功能落地的同时保持稳定性。

让我们把注意力回到法甲的特殊性。法甲联赛赛程并非完全对称,球队之间的对抗强度与休息时间差异较大,数据模型需要对这种偏差有容错处理。及时更新的赛果、清晰的后续计划和对手强弱分析,能让排名更有“故事性”,媒体报道也更具可读性。

最后,一些使用场景和风险点需要清楚:媒体需要快速可靠的结果来写稿,***公司和分析团队则关注长期稳定性和可扩展性,俱乐部内部需要数据可解释性强的指标体系。若数据源出现缺失,系统应给出明确的警报与替代方案,避免因数据空缺导致的误导。

你可能在想,市面上到底有哪些现成方案合适?答案因需求而异:有偏向完整端到端解决的,有偏向数据服务的,有偏向自建灵活扩展的。选择时要看数据源质量、实时性、API可用性、可视化表达能力以及成本结构。最关键的是,看它能不能真正帮助你讲清楚“积分是谁说了算、为什么这么算、下一步怎么办”的故事。

如果你愿意自己动手搭建一套系统,先从需求清单开始,列出你最在乎的指标和报表形式。再画出数据流图,明确每个模块的输入输出。然后用小规模的测试集验证排序规则的稳定性,逐步扩展到正式运行。过程中的每一次迭代都像训练新招式,慢慢你就能把“数字看法”变成“直观讲解”的强力工具。

最后的问题来了,数据像球一样在场上滚来滚去,你准备好把它们带回到你的小本子里,用一张表、一幅图讲清楚法甲的每一个名次吗?如果你已经在脑海里想象那份可视化了,那就让我们把它落地,看看页面上那些数字会不会笑着给你点个赞。

免责声明
           本站所有信息均来自互联网搜集
1.与产品相关信息的真实性准确性均由发布单位及个人负责,
2.拒绝任何人以任何形式在本站发表与中华人民共和国法律相抵触的言论
3.请大家仔细辨认!并不代表本站观点,本站对此不承担任何相关法律责任!
4.如果发现本网站有任何文章侵犯你的权益,请立刻联系本站站长[ *** :775191930],通知给予删除